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- CMD:adminchat(playerid, params[])
- {
- new msg[128];
- if(gLogged[playerid] == 0) return SendClientMessage(playerid, COLOR_ERROR, "You are not logged in.");
- if(PlayerInfo[playerid][pAdmin] < 1) return SendClientMessage(playerid, COLOR_ERROR, "Your admin level is not high enough to use this command.");
- if(sscanf(params,"s[128]",msg)) return SendClientMessage(playerid, COLOR_SYN, "Synthax:{FFFFFF} (/a)dminchat <text>");
- {
- if(PlayerInfo[playerid][pAdmin] == 9)
- {
- format(gString, sizeof(gString), "** Fondator %s[%d] : %s **", GetName(playerid), playerid, msg);
- }
- if(PlayerInfo[playerid][pAdmin] == 8)
- {
- format(gString, sizeof(gString), "** Scripter %s[%d] : %s **", GetName(playerid), playerid, msg);
- }
- if(PlayerInfo[playerid][pAdmin] == 7)
- {
- format(gString, sizeof(gString), "** Owner %s[%d] : %s **", GetName(playerid), playerid, msg);
- }
- else format(gString, sizeof(gString), "** Admin Level %d %s[%d] : %s **", PlayerInfo[playerid][pAdmin], GetName(playerid), playerid, msg);
- new string2[128];
- if(strlen(gString) > 120)
- {
- strmid(string2, gString, 110, 256);
- strdel(gString, 110, 256);
- format(gString,128,"%s ...",gString);
- ABroadCast(COLOR_AC, gString, 1);
- format(string2,128,"... %s",string2);
- ABroadCast(COLOR_AC, string2, 1);
- }
- else
- {
- ABroadCast(COLOR_AC, gString, 1);
- }
- }
- return 1;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ement